## Platform architecture Gradle is arranged into several coarse-grained components called "platforms". Each platform provides support for some kind of automation, such as building JVM software or building Gradle plugins. Most platforms typically build on the features of other platforms. By understanding the Gradle platforms and their relationships, you can get a feel for where in the Gradle source a particular feature might be implemented.
